5* MemeticMutation: [[http://knowyourmeme.com/memes/is-this-a-pigeon Is this a pigeon?]] [[labelnote:explanation]]A scene of Yutaro erroneously identifying a butterfly as a pigeon. On Tumblr, the quote, along with a reaction image of the scene featuring the English subtitle, is widely used to express utter confusion. The meme later saw a resurgence in 2018, usually to mock someone who's falsely identifying something like Yutaro does.[[/labelnote]]
